Design Features
The obverse of the coin showcases a striking portrait of King Peroz, adorned with regal attire and a majestic crown, exuding power and authority. On the reverse, intricate inscriptions in Brahmi script adorn the surface, adding a touch of sophistication to the overall design.
Technical Specifications
This silver coin weighs 3.94g, reflecting the skilled craftsmanship of ancient minting processes. The Drachm denomination signifies its value in the Kidarite monetary system, highlighting its importance in daily transactions and regional trade.
